CTO National Certification
The CTO National Certification course is a 24-hour course that is for the individual who conducts shift-level agency on-the-job training program for new employees. The CTO candidate should be an experienced and formally trained
emergency communications employee, who desires to train others with a structured on-the-job training program.
Course Purpose
The purpose of the course is to teach the CTO candidate how to conduct one-on-one OJT training as required by the agency and according to written performance objectives.
Upon completion of the CTO Certification course the student will be have the following skills:
- Execute the agency performance-based on-the-job training program
- Implement a standardized training schedule
- Follow written performance objectives
- Utilize a performance objective rating system
- Utilize the various OJT forms and reports
- Execute the agency OJT program
- Conduct one-on-one OJT training as required
NOTE: The CTO Certification does not qualify the individual to conduct academic classroom training which is reserved for the 9-1-1 Basic Instructor.
To qualify as a 9-1-1 Basic Instructor requires the attendance at a 9-1-1 Basic Instructor certification course.
